The Pillars of Stellar Customer Support
So, what separates the good from the truly exceptional when it comes to casino customer support? Several key elements define a service that truly caters to the needs of experienced players.
Responsiveness: Time is Money
In the fast-paced world of online gambling, time is of the essence. A delay in resolving an issue can mean missed opportunities, lost bets, or unnecessary frustration. Look for casinos that offer multiple contact options, including live chat, email, and ideally, a phone line. Live chat should be staffed 24/7, with agents readily available to address your concerns. Email response times should be measured in hours, not days. Phone support should connect you to a knowledgeable representative quickly and efficiently. Test these channels before you commit serious funds. A quick response time is a sign that the casino values your time and business.

Leveraging Customer Support: Tips for the Savvy Player
Knowing how to effectively interact with customer support can significantly improve your overall experience.
Document Everything: Keep a Record
Always keep a record of your interactions with customer support, including the date, time, and a summary of the conversation. This can be invaluable if you need to escalate an issue or file a complaint.
Be Clear and Concise: Get to the Point
Clearly state your issue or question, providing all relevant information. This will help the support agent understand your needs and resolve your issue more quickly.
Be Polite but Assertive: Stand Your Ground
Maintain a polite and respectful tone, but don’t be afraid to assert your rights. If you’re not satisfied with the response you receive, politely request to speak to a supervisor or escalate the issue.
Know Your Rights: Understand the Rules
Familiarize yourself with the casino’s terms and conditions, bonus rules, and dispute resolution procedures. This will help you understand your rights and navigate any issues that may arise.
Use Multiple Channels: Explore All Options
If you’re not getting the answers you need through one channel, try another. Contacting the casino via live chat, email, and phone can sometimes yield different results.
